Angel Face is one of those films that teeters on the edge of unsettling and enchanting. It sets up this eerie atmosphere, where the seemingly innocent characters slowly peel back layers of darkness. The practical effects are surprisingly effective, and they really enhance the unsettling vibe. The pacing is a bit uneven at times, but it adds to the feeling of dread that hangs thick in the air. You can see the performances are committed, bringing a certain authenticity to their unsettling roles. It's definitely distinctive in its approach to exploring the duality of innocence and evil.
Angel Face has a rather obscure status in the collector's sphere, with limited releases across formats. Its rarity plays into the allure, especially for those interested in the psychological horror niche. Finding it can be a bit of a hunt, which certainly adds to its collectible nature. Enthusiasts often appreciate the film for its unique blend of unsettling themes and practical effects, making it a conversation starter among genre fans.
